引言
在数据分析领域,SAS(Statistical Analysis System)是一种非常强大的数据处理和分析工具。它不仅可以进行复杂的数据处理,还可以将处理后的数据输出到不同的格式,例如Excel和CSV。掌握SAS数据输出的技巧,可以帮助我们更高效地完成数据分析工作。本文将详细介绍SAS如何将数据输出到Excel和CSV格式,并探讨其在实际应用中的优势。
SAS数据输出到Excel
1. 使用PROC EXPORT过程
SAS中,PROC EXPORT过程可以帮助我们将数据输出到Excel文件。以下是使用PROC EXPORT的步骤:
proc export data=your_data_file
outfile="path_to_your_excel_file.xlsx"
dbms=xlsx
replace;
run;
data=your_data_file:指定要输出的数据集。outfile="path_to_your_excel_file.xlsx":指定输出文件的路径和文件名。dbms=xlsx:指定输出文件的格式为Excel(.xlsx)。replace:如果输出文件已存在,则覆盖原有文件。
2. 使用PROC PRINT过程
另外,我们还可以使用PROC PRINT过程将数据输出到Excel。以下是使用PROC PRINT的步骤:
proc print data=your_data_file
outfile="path_to_your_excel_file.xlsx"
dbms=xlsx
style=excel;
run;
style=excel:指定输出文件的样式为Excel。
SAS数据输出到CSV
1. 使用PROC DATASETS过程
SAS中,PROC DATASETS过程可以帮助我们将数据输出到CSV文件。以下是使用PROC DATASETS的步骤:
proc datasets lib=your_library nolist;
copy in=your_data_file out=your_csv_file
options=csv;
run;
quit;
lib=your_library:指定数据集所在库。in=your_data_file:指定要输出的数据集。out=your_csv_file:指定输出文件的路径和文件名。options=csv:指定输出文件的格式为CSV。
2. 使用PROC EXPORT过程
我们还可以使用PROC EXPORT过程将数据输出到CSV文件。以下是使用PROC EXPORT的步骤:
proc export data=your_data_file
outfile="path_to_your_csv_file.csv"
dbms=csv;
run;
outfile="path_to_your_csv_file.csv":指定输出文件的路径和文件名。dbms=csv:指定输出文件的格式为CSV。
实际应用中的优势
将SAS数据输出到Excel和CSV格式,在实际应用中具有以下优势:
- 方便共享:Excel和CSV格式的文件可以方便地在不同平台和软件之间共享和交换。
- 易于阅读:Excel和CSV格式的文件具有清晰的表格结构,便于阅读和分析。
- 支持多种工具:Excel和CSV格式的文件可以支持多种数据分析工具,如Excel、Python、R等。
总结
本文介绍了SAS高效数据输出技巧,包括将数据输出到Excel和CSV格式。通过学习这些技巧,我们可以更高效地完成数据分析工作。在实际应用中,掌握这些技巧将使我们的工作更加轻松和便捷。
